An abstract photograph by June Sharpe has won this year's International Garden Photographer of the Year competition.

"The layered branches of this conifer reminded me of the dancing cranes often featured in Japanese woodcuts," said Sharpe.

"Now, more than ever, it is vitally important to connect with nature and highlight the beauty and fragility of our planet's ecosystems."

In post-processing, Sharpe enhanced what she describes as a "sense of the 'birds' dancing in a fantasy woodland".

Head judge Tyrone McGlinchey said: "When judging pictures we are hoping to be embraced, and taken on a journey, within a story.

"We are pulled into and beyond the symbolic dancing cranes, and embraced by their 'wings', to a place of hope and peace. It is rare that one can connect with nature and feel such compassion."
